Mortlake Station is well-equipped with facilities that cater to a wide range of passengers. The ticket office is open from early morning to mid-evening on weekdays, and slightly adjusted hours on weekends, enabling both advance and spur-of-the-moment travel. Ticket machines are available, helping you collect pre-purchased tickets with ease, and they are also equipped with facilities for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
For those needing assistance, induction loops are provided, though it's important to note that there isn't staff help on-site. The station has step-free access for those who need it, ensuring that all travelers can navigate with ease.
For those passing through, a cozy coffee shop on platform 1 offers refreshment options. Despite the lack of an ATM or shops, the station's amenities meet basic needs, making any waiting time more comfortable with public Wi-Fi and payphones available for use.

The station features a variety of amenities designed to make your commute as comfortable and convenient as possible. Open from 06:30 to 10:00 on weekdays, the ticket office is there to assist with your travel needs. If you're in a hurry, or outside of these hours, ticket machines are available for purchasing or collecting tickets bought online. These machines are tailored for accessibility and support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
For those utilizing smartcards, both issuance and validation facilities are available at the station, ensuring swift and seamless travel. The station also incorporates induction loops for those requiring audio assistance. While facilities like luggage storage and refreshment options are currently not available, the station prioritizes security with CCTV consistently monitoring the premises.
Drayton Park station, classified as a Category C station, unfortunately lacks step-free access. The assistance meeting point is strategically located by the ticket office to assist travelers as needed. Staff are present on weekdays until 10:00 to help with your arrival and departure. For those requiring further travel support, help points are conveniently placed on platforms, and a free helpline is available to arrange for any required assistance.
While there are no waiting rooms, seating is provided for your comfort as you await your train. Unfortunately, the station does not feature accessible toilets or parking accommodations, which may pose challenges for some travelers. Cycling enthusiasts will find stands to secure their bicycles, safeguarded by station CCTV.
